Mumbai Crime: School girl thrashed for not completing homework

Family files FIR against teacher; police yet to make arrest

A teacher has been accused of brutally thrashing a 14-year-old student of RC Patel High School on Saturday. The girl's parents have filed a complaint with the Borivli police, but no arrests have been made in the case.


The girl, Chetana Raju Sharma, in her statement to the police, said that on Saturday, the teacher, Namrata Ojha, who teaches Hindi and Gujarati, asked those students who had not completed their homework to stand up. Twelve students stood up, including Chetana. She said about one-and-a-half months ago, her family had relocated to another house, during which she had misplaced her notebook. She requested the teacher to give her time to complete the notebook and submit it, but the teacher, allegedly, started hitting her on her right hand with three steel rulers.


After the lecture, Chetana's class monitor applied balm on her hand, which helped her attend the next lecture, but eventually her hand swelled up. After school, when she reached home, she told her mother about the incident. Her mother took her to Shatabdi Hospital where the doctor applied a plaster on her hand. Two days later when the pain did not subside, Chetana and her mother visited the family doctor, who said Chetana had suffered some serious injuries, which would take some time to heal.

On January 29, Chetana's family approached Borivli Police Station and lodged a complaint against the teacher. The police have registered an FIR against Ojha and are investigating the matter. The family has requested the school principal to suspend the teacher.
